Biography

Gyul E. Kim (b. 1990, South Korea) explores art through a process of deciphering signs and symbols that through a retrace of one’s steps, allows for self discovery. Kim reconfigures the boundaries of painting by first composing an image and then producing a canvas shaped to match it. This approach disrupts the traditional rectangular frame and flexibly expands possibilities of interpretation.

Drawing from geometric fragments observed in everyday life and the exaggerated visual language of classic animation, Kim develops a distinctive vocabulary of angular, nonconforming forms. This departs from conventional standards and generates a sense of visual dynamism and playfulness that is sourced in the artist’s engagement with marginalization and difference. Rather than resolve the dissonance of language and incomprehensibility, her work embraces ambiguity as points of fascination.
